After another disappointing weekend for Australian rugby, we need your questions for this week’s edition of Coach’s Corner.

If you’re new here, Coach’s Corner is the weekly Friday column where our very own rugby guru Nick Bishop answers all your questions about the greatest game.

» Didn’t see Coach’s Corner last week? Get up to speed on all the talking points here

A second clean sweep for the New Zealand sides in Super Rugby Trans-Tasman has led to plenty of doom and gloom about the state of the sport in Australia, with even Crusaders coach Scott Robertson bemoaning the gulf in class from across the ditch. Are there any positives to take out of the weekend’s action, and can someone – anyone – step up to break the duck?

This week’s matches are headlined by the Reds looking for redemption from their horror loss to the Crusaders when they battle the Chiefs, while the Force and the Brumbies will each be hoping they can be the ones to secure that long-awaited Lucky Country victory.

Elsewhere in the world of rugby, the Japanese Top League wrapped up with another title for Robbie Deans’ Panasonic Wild Knights, while Cheslin Kolbe and Antoine Dupont led Toulouse to glory in the European Rugby Champions Cup tournament.

Nick is on hand to answer your questions about the ongoing Super Rugby competition, as well as all the other action from around the globe. Something on your mind? Be sure to leave it in the comments section below, and don’t forget to check back in on Friday to see what he has to say!
